•
Epoxy meets UL 94 V-0 flammability rating
Moisture Sensitivity Level 1
Terminals:solderable per MIL-STD-750, Method 2026
Polarity:Color band denotes positive end(cathode)
except Bidirectional
o
Maximum soldering temperature:260 C for 10 seconds
Manufacturing code added for better tracking
